Hi there

  • I’m currently a PhD student at UniPi 🔭
  • My research work is mainly focused on the Neuro-Symbolic aspect of Artificial Intelligence, i.e the combination of Deep Learning models with logic-symbolic knowledge. The goal is to be able to integrate logic into neural systems, transforming them into intelligent agents with reasoning abilities. Furthermore, provide a higher level of trustworthiness and comprehension of such systems. 🧠
  • I would like to tackle problems with a positive social impact with AI (AI4PEOPLE/AI4GOOD).
